  • Abstract
    This paper reports on the synthesis, characterisation, and efficiency of a new intravenous conjugate of amphotericin B (AMB). Twelve molecules of AMB were attached to block copolymer poly(ethylene glycol)-b-poly(l-lysine) via pH-sensitive imine linkages. In vitro drug release studies demonstrated the conjugate (Mw = 26,700) to be relatively stable in human plasma and in phosphate buffer (pH 7.4, 37 °C). Controlled release of AMB was observed in acidic phosphate buffer (pH 5.5, 37 °C) with the half-life of 2 min. The LD50 value determined in vivo (mouse) is 45 mg/kg.
